数控铣c轴打孔怎么编程

时间:2025-01-28 00:32:03 网络游戏

数控铣床进行C轴打孔编程通常涉及以下步骤:

确定机床坐标系和工件坐标系的原点位置 :这是编程的基础,确保所有坐标点都相对于同一个参考点进行计算和编程。

确定钻孔位置的坐标点:

根据设计要求,在工件上标出每个需要钻孔的位置的坐标点。这些坐标点可以是绝对坐标或相对于工件原点的相对坐标。

选择编程方式

点位编程:

适用于少量、简单的钻孔加工。编程步骤包括确定每个钻孔位置的坐标,并将这些坐标输入数控铣床的编程界面,形成钻孔程序。点位编程的优点是简单易学,但适应性较差,不适合复杂路径。

螺旋线编程:适用于需要多个连续钻孔位置的情况。编程步骤包括确定钻孔的起点、终点、深度以及螺旋线的升降方向等参数,计算出螺旋线的坐标点序列,并将这些坐标点输入数控铣床的编程界面,形成钻孔程序。螺旋线编程的优点是适应性强,可以处理复杂路径,但编程难度较高。

设定钻孔参数:

包括钻头直径、钻头进给速度、旋转速度和切削进给速度等。这些参数应根据具体加工要求进行调整,以确保加工质量和效率。

决定钻孔顺序:

根据工件的几何形状和加工要求,决定钻孔的顺序。通常按照逻辑顺序进行钻孔,如果需要避开固定夹具或其他障碍物,还需要进行相应的调整。

编程界面输入:

将计算好的坐标点和参数输入数控铣床的编程界面,形成完整的钻孔程序。不同的数控系统和编程软件可能有不同的操作方式,需要根据具体系统进行相应的操作。

模拟和测试:

在正式加工前,进行模拟编程和测试,以验证程序的正确性和可行性,避免实际加工中出现错误。

加工:

按照编程好的程序进行实际加工,注意观察加工过程中的情况,及时调整参数,确保加工质量和安全。

建议在实际编程过程中,先进行充分的模拟和测试,确保程序无误后再进行实际加工,以减少错误和返工。